In Port Wentworth and the surrounding Chatham County area, senior living costs generally fall into several categories. Independent living communities, which are ideal for active seniors who need minimal assistance, are often the most affordable tier. These typically involve a monthly rent that covers housing, meals, and basic utilities. Assisted living, which provides help with daily activities like bathing, dressing, and medication management, represents a mid-range cost. Memory care for those with Alzheimer’s or other dementias, offering specialized secure environments and programs, is usually at a higher price point due to the increased staff training and resident supervision required. Finally, skilled nursing facilities provide the most intensive medical care and are typically the most expensive.
For a local perspective, families should know that Georgia’s overall cost of living tends to be slightly below the national average, which can be reflected in senior care. However, being part of the vibrant Savannah metropolitan area means Port Wentworth benefits from a range of options while also experiencing costs that may be higher than in more rural parts of the state. It’s very common to see assisted living base rates in our region starting in the range of $3,500 to $4,500 per month. This base rate often covers room, board, and a standard set of services, but it is critical to ask what is included. Additional costs for higher levels of personal care, medication administration, or specialized transportation can add significantly to the monthly bill.
A practical and highly recommended step is to schedule in-person tours at a few communities that seem like a good fit. During these visits, ask detailed questions about the fee structure. Inquire about any community fees or move-in deposits, how care needs are assessed and priced, and what the policy is if care needs increase. Many facilities use a tiered pricing model based on the amount of assistance required. Also, don’t hesitate to discuss financial options. Many families utilize a combination of private funds, long-term care insurance, veterans benefits, and in some cases, Medicaid waiver programs for those who qualify. Georgia’s SOURCE and CCSP waiver programs can help eligible individuals receive services in an assisted living setting, though not all communities accept these waivers.
